Moses Asks How the Corpse-Defiled Are Purified by the Red Heifer

Midrash Tanchuma Buber, Chukat 20:1

[Another interpretation (of Ecclesiastes 8:1): "Who is like the wise person?" This is Moses, of whom it is written (Proverbs 21:22): "A wise man scaled the city of the mighty." "And who knows the interpretation of a matter?" — for he interpreted the Torah for Israel. "A person's wisdom lights up his face."] Rabbi Joshua of Sikhnin said in the name of Rabbi Levi: Concerning each and every matter that the Holy One, blessed be He, would say to Moses, He would tell him its uncleanness and its purification. When He reached the section "Speak unto the priests" (Leviticus 21), Moses said before Him: Master of the Universe, and if he becomes unclean, by what means is his purification? And He did not answer him. At that hour the face of Moses turned pale. This is what is written: "And the strength of his face is changed." And when He reached the section of the Heifer, the Holy One, blessed be He, said to him: Moses, that saying which I said to you, "Go, speak unto the priests," and you said to Me, "If he becomes unclean, by what means shall his purification be?", and I did not answer you — this is his purification: "And they shall take for the unclean person from the ashes of the burning of the sin-offering" (Numbers 19:17).
